FAQS on mining excavators at work

Q: What types of excavators are commonly used in mining operations?

A: Hydraulic mining excavators and electric rope shovels are the most common types. They are designed for heavy-duty material handling and operate in large-scale mining sites. Their high power and durability make them ideal for extracting minerals and overburden removal.

Q: How do mining excavators improve operational efficiency?

A: Mining excavators enhance efficiency through advanced automation, GPS-guided digging, and real-time data monitoring. These features optimize digging precision and reduce fuel consumption. Faster cycle times and minimized downtime further boost productivity.

Q: What safety features are integrated into modern mining excavators?

A: Modern excavators include collision avoidance systems, 360-degree cameras, and fatigue-monitoring sensors. Reinforced cabins protect operators from debris and rollovers. Automated shutdown mechanisms prevent accidents during equipment malfunctions.

Q: How do mining excavators differ from standard construction excavators?

A: Mining excavators are larger, with higher load capacities and reinforced structures for extreme conditions. They often include specialized attachments for rock-breaking and bulk material handling. Their engines and hydraulics are built for continuous operation in harsh environments.

Q: What other machinery is typically included in a mining machinery list?

A: A mining machinery list often includes haul trucks, drills, bulldozers, and wheel loaders. These machines work alongside excavators for drilling, transporting, and processing materials. Each plays a critical role in ensuring seamless mining operations.
